Ana Martínez Orizondo (AMO) is a Cuban born visual artist, poet, and Emmy award-wining producer living in Miami, Florida. Ana has exhibited in group shows at Miami International Fine Arts (MIFA), in New York at The Painting Center, View Center for Arts and Culture, East End Arts, and online at The Curator’s Salon and Visionary Arts Collective, among others. She collaborated with fashion designer Gabriela Hearst on her Fall Winter 2022 collection and was the inaugural artist-in-residence at The Chequit, Shelter Island with a solo show from her Tree Stories series. She is currently an artist-in-residence at MIFA. Her artwork resides in private collections and has been featured nationally and internationally in Vogue Mexico & Latin America, Orion, The Cut, Cottages & Gardens, Art Seen Magazine, and EcoTheo Review, among others. Her writing has appeared in Blue Mountain Review, Newtown Literary, and The Journal of Latina Critical Feminism, to name a few. Her first chapbook, That Place, won third place in the Finishing Line Press 2022-2023 Chapbook Competition and is slated for publishing in Spring 2024. She holds an MA in Liberal Arts from Florida International University and a BA in Latin American Literature and Communications from the University of Pennsylvania.
